Fans have noticed the 'brilliant' moment Antonio Rudiger helped Andriy Lunin save ex-Chelsea teammate Mateo Kovacic's penalty.

Real Madrid reached the Champions League semi-finals for the fourth year in a row, beating Manchester City 4-3 in a penalty shootout after the game ended 4-4 on aggregate following extra time.

Former Chelsea teammates Rudiger and Kovacic, who left Stamford Bridge in 2022 and 2023 respectively, went head-to-head the Etihad.

But despite playing with each other for three years and winning the Champions League together, fans have spotted the moment Rudiger helped end Kovacic and his side's run in the competition.

The pressure was on for the City star as he prepared to take his spot-kick, with Bernardo Silva already missing to keep the score in the shootout level following Luka Modric's initial miss.

Rudiger, who waited on the half way line in the Real Madrid huddle, was seen signalling to Los Blancos goalkeeper Lunin, pointing to the left, appearing to suggest which way Kovacic would shoot.

His knowledge on his former Chelsea teammate appeared to pay off, with Lunin getting down on that side to save the penalty.

Modric was then seen smiling up at Rudiger as the ex-Blues defender celebrated.

Chelsea fans made note of their former player's antics, too.

"Rudiger said Kovacic was his best friend and then told Lunin where Kovacic was gonna shoot for his penalty!" one wrote on X.

Since joining Real Madrid, Rudiger revealed in an interview that Kovacic is still his closest friend in the sport.

"My best friend in football is Mateo Kovacic," he told Madrid's official YouTube channel.

But thanks to Lunin's penalty heroics and Rudiger's helping hand, Real Madrid will now face Bayern Munich - who saw off Arsenal on the same night - in the semi-finals.
